/* ================================
    CSS STYLES FOR THE COMMERCE STARTER KIT 
    v1.0, 10/2002
   ================================
*/   
/*
	Color de fondo #dddca3
	Color de primer plano #999966
*/


*{font-family:Verdana, Arial}
body{font-size:12px;}
H1{text-align:left;color: #999966;font-size:20px;}
H2{text-decoration:underline;text-align:center;color: #999966;font-size:20px;}
H3{background-color: #dddca3;text-align:left;color: dimgray;font-size:20px;	padding:5 15 5 15; margin:5 15 5 15;}

.ESI{float:left;width:10px; height:10px; font-size:1px; background:#fff url(images/01.gif) no-repeat left top;position:relative; top:-16; left:-6}
.ESD{float:right;width:10px; height:10px; font-size:1px; background:#fff url(images/02.gif) no-repeat right top;position:relative; top:-16; right:-6}
.EII{float:left;width:10px; height:10px; font-size:1px; background:#fff url(images/03.gif) no-repeat left bottom;position:relative; bottom:-16; left:-6}
.EID{float:right;width:10px; height:10px; font-size:1px; background:#fff url(images/04.gif) no-repeat right bottom;position:relative; bottom:-16; right:-6}


.ESIf{float:left;width:5px; height:5px; font-size:1px; background:#fff url(images/f1.gif) no-repeat left top;position:relative; top:-5; left:-15}
.ESDf{float:right;width:5px; height:5px; font-size:1px; background:#fff url(images/f2.gif) no-repeat right top;position:relative; top:-5; right:-15}
.EIIf{float:left;width:5px; height:5px; font-size:1px; background:#fff url(images/f3.gif) no-repeat left bottom;position:relative; bottom:5; left:0;}
.EIDf{float:right;width:5px; height:5px; font-size:1px; background:#fff url(images/f4.gif) no-repeat right bottom;position:relative; bottom:5; right:0;}
html>body .EIIf{bottom:0; left:-15;}
html>body .EIDf{bottom:0; right:-15;}

.ESIf1{float:left;width:5px; height:5px; font-size:1px; background:#fff url(images/f1.gif) no-repeat left top;position:relative; top:-5; left:-5}
.ESDf1{float:right;width:5px; height:5px; font-size:1px; background:#fff url(images/f2.gif) no-repeat right top;position:relative; top:-5; right:-5}
.EIIf1{float:left;width:5px; height:5px; font-size:1px; background:#fff url(images/f3.gif) no-repeat left bottom;position:relative; bottom:-3; left:-5}
.EIDf1{float:right;width:5px; height:5px; font-size:1px; background:#fff url(images/f4.gif) no-repeat right bottom;position:relative;bottom:-3; right:-5}
html>body .EIIf1{bottom:-5; left:-5;}
html>body .EIDf1{bottom:-5; right:-5;}

.Menu{font-size:12px;background-color: #dddca3;padding:15px;height:100%;overflow:auto; width:250px;}
.Menu div{border:0px;}
.Menu img{vertical-align:middle;}
.Menu nobr{overflow:hidden;}
.Menu span{padding-left:5px;font-weight:bold}
.Menu i {color:#556F01; text-decoration:italic; font-size:11px}
.Menu b{text-decoration:none;padding:2px; cursor:pointer;}
.Menu b.anclahover{border:1px solid #996;}

#Cuerpo{margin:0px;padding:15px;vertical-align:top;height:100%;overflow:auto;}

.ProductListItem{width:230px;float:left;border:1px solid #999966;padding:15 5 15 5;margin:10px;text-align:center; cursor:pointer;}
.ProductListItem .ModelName{background-color:#dddca3;color:dimgray;font-weight:bold;padding:5 5 8 5;margin:0 5 0 5;}
.ProductListItem img{border:0px; width:100px; height:75px;margin:15px;}
.ProductListItem div.Oferta{width:127px; height:102px; position:absolute; background:url(images/ofertaico.gif) no-repeat;}
.ProductListItem div.Oferta span{width:100%;color:#999966;font-size:14px;font-family:Impact;border:3px solid #999966;background-color:#dddca3;position:relative;top:75px;}

 html>body .ProductListItem .ModelName{padding:5 5 10 5;}
 
 div.Carrito A{color:#9D0000;margin:15px; font-weight:bold;}
.volver {color:#9D0000;margin:15px; font-weight:bold;}

.ProductDetail{width:100%;margin:15px;}
.ProductDetail img{width:350px;border:0px;margin:15 0 15 0;}
.ProductDetail DIV.Producto{float:left;color: dimgray; width:400px; border:1px solid #999966;text-align:center; padding:15 5 15 5; margin:0 15 0 15;}	

.ProductDetail div.Oferta{width:260px; height:200px; position:absolute; background:url(images/oferta.gif) no-repeat;}
.ProductDetail div.Oferta span{width:200px;color:#999966;font-size:18px;font-family:Impact;border:3px solid #999966;background-color:#dddca3;position:relative;top:160px;}
.ProductList{width:100%;margin:15px;clear:both;padding:15 0 0 0;}
.ProductDetail .Descripcion{font:normal 1em Verdana; line-height:1.5em;}
/*  .ProductList div{padding:5px}*/

.OfertaGrande{BACKGROUND: url(images/oferta.gif) no-repeat; POSITION:absolute;TEXT-ALIGN: center;Width:264;Height:178;}
.OfertaGrande span{color:#999966;width:175px;font-size:large;font-family:Impact;font-weight:bold;border:5px solid #999966;background-color:#dddca3;position:relative;top:125px;}

.Oferta1{color:#9D0000;font-weight:bold;font-size:16pt;}
.welcome{font:bold italic 14px Verdana;}
BODY
{	
	height: 100%;
	scroll: No;
	scrollbar-3dlight-color:    #999966;
	scrollbar-arrow-color:      #999966;
	scrollbar-darkshadow-color: #999966;
	scrollbar-face-color:       #dddca3;
	scrollbar-highlight-color:  #dddca3;
	scrollbar-shadow-color:     #dddca3;
	scrollbar-track-color:      #999966
}


/* */
.HomeHead
{
    color: #999966;
    font-family: Verdana, Arial;
    font-size: 20px;
    font-weight: bold;
    HEIGHT: 35px;
}

/* */
.ContentHead
{
    background-color: #dddca3;
    color: dimgray;
    font-family: Verdana, Arial;
    font-size: 20px;
    font-weight: bold;
    height: 35px
}

/* */
.SubContentHead
{
    background-color: #dddca3;
    color: dimgray;
    font-family: Verdana, Arial;
    font-size: 18px;
    font-weight: bold;
    height: 20px
}

/* */
.UnitCost
{
    color: #808080;
    font-family: Verdana, Arial;
    font-size: 15px;
    line-height: 20pt
}

/* */
.ModelNumber
{
    color: #808080;
    font-family: Verdana, Arial;
    font-size: 11px;
    line-height: 20pt
}

/* */
.ErrorText
{
    color: red;
    font-family: Verdana, Arial;
    font-size: 12px;
    line-height: 20pt
}
.MostPopularHead
{
    background-color: #dddca3;
    color: #000000;
    font-family: Verdana, Arial;
    font-size: 11px;
    font-weight: bold;
    padding-bottom:2px;
    padding-top:2px;
}

.buscar
{    
    color: white;
    font-family: Verdana, Arial;
    font-size: 13px;
    font-weight: bold;
    text-decoration: none    
}

A.MostPopularItemText, A.MostPopularItemText:link, A.MostPopularItemText:visited
{
    color: black;
    font-family: Verdana, Arial;
    font-size: 11px;
    text-decoration: none
}

A.MostPopularItemText:hover
{
    color: red;
    font-family: Verdana, Arial;
    font-size: 11px;
    text-decoration: underline
}

.ProductListHead
{
    color: black;
    font-family: Verdana, Arial;
    font-size: 12px;
    font-weight: bold;
    line-height: 14pt;
    text-decoration: underline;
}
.ProductListItem
{
    color: black;
    font-family: Verdana, Arial;
    font-size: 10px
}

.CartListHead
{
    background-color: #dddca3;
    border-bottom: dimgray;
    border-left: dimgray 1px solid;
    color: black;
    font-family: Verdana, Arial;
    font-size: 11px;
    font-weight: bold;
    line-height: 20pt;
    padding-left: 5px
}

.CartListItem
{
    background-color: #ffffff;
    border-bottom: dimgray;
    border-left: dimgray 1px solid;
    color: black;
    font-family: Verdana, Arial;
    font-size: 11px;
    padding-left: 5px
}

.CartListItemAlt
{
    background-color: #f2f2f2;
    border-bottom: dimgray;
    border-left: dimgray 1px solid;
    color: black;
    font-family: Verdana, Arial;
    font-size: 11px;
    padding-left: 5px
}

.CartListFooter
{
    background-color: #dddca3;
    line-height: 10pt
}

/* text style for the links */
A.SiteLink, A.SiteLink:link, A.SiteLink:visited
{
    font-family: Verdana, Helvetica, sans-serif;
    text-decoration: none;
    color: #dddddd;
    font-size: 11px;
    cursor:pointer;
}   

A.SiteLink:hover    
{
    text-decoration: underline;
    color: white;
}

.SiteLinkBold, A.SiteLinkBold:link, A.SiteLinkBold:visited
{
    color: #dddddd;
    font-family: Verdana, Helvetica, sans-serif;
    text-decoration: none;
    font-size:  11px;
    font-weight: bold;
        cursor:pointer;
}


A.SiteLinkBold:hover
{
    color: white;
    text-decoration: none    
}

A.aimage, A.aimage:Link, A.aimage:visited
{
	text-decoration: none
}

/* */
A.MenuUnselected, A.MenuUnselected:link, A.MenuUnselected:visited
{
    color: goldenrod;
    font-family: Verdana, Helvetica, sans-serif;
    text-decoration: none;
    font-size:  12px;
    font-weight: bold;
    line-height: 16px;
    padding-left: 10px
}

A.MenuUnselected:hover
{
    color: white;
    text-decoration: underline;
    padding-left: 10px
}

A.MenuSelected
{
    color: white;
    font-family: Verdana, Helvetica, sans-serif;
    text-decoration: none;
    font-size:  16px;
    font-weight: bold;
    line-height: 16px;
    padding-left: 10px
}

A.MenuSelected:hover
{
    color: white;
    font-family: Verdana, Helvetica, sans-serif;
    text-decoration: none;
    padding-left: 10px
}

/* GENERAL */

/* text style used for most text rendered by modules */
.Normal
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
    line-height: 12px    
}

.NormalDouble
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
    line-height: 20px    
}

/* text style used for textboxes in the admin pages, for Nav compatibility */
.NormalTextBox
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 1.2em;
    font-weight: normal;
}

/* text style used for selects in the admin pages, for Nav compatibility */
.NormalSelect
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 1.2em;
    font-weight: normal;
}

/* text style used for textboxes in the edit pages, for Nav compatibility */
.EditTextBox
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 1em;
    font-weight: normal;
    border-style: solid;
    border-width: 1px;
    border-color: #999966;
    width: 100%;
}

/* text style used for controls in the admin and edit pages, for Nav compatibility */
.NormalControl
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
}

/* text style used for checkboxes in the admin and edit pages, for Nav compatibility */
.NormalCheckBox
{
    margin-left: -4px;
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
}

/* text style used for checkboxes in the admin and edit pages, for Nav compatibility */
.NormalRadio
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
    text-indent: -5px;
}

/* text style used for checkboxes in the admin and edit pages, for Nav compatibility */
.NormalButton
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: normal;
    text-indent: -5px;
/*    border-style: solid;
    border-width: 1px;
    border-color: #cccc99; */
    background-color:#ccccaa;    
}

.NormalRed
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: bold;
    color: red
}

.NormalBold
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: bold;
    line-height: 12px    
}

.NormalItalic
{
    font-family: Verdana, Helvetica, sans-serif;
    font-size: 11px;
    font-weight: bold;
    line-height: 16px    
}

.scroll 
{
	height: 100%;
	width: 100%;
	overflow: scroll;
	border: 0px	 solid #666;	
	background-color: #dddca3;
	padding: 8px;		
	scrollbar-3dlight-color:    #999966;
	scrollbar-arrow-color:      #999966;
	scrollbar-darkshadow-color: #999966;
	scrollbar-face-color:       #dddca3;
	scrollbar-highlight-color:  #dddca3;
	scrollbar-shadow-color:     #dddca3;
	scrollbar-track-color:      #999966

}

.scroll2 
{
	height: 100%;
	width: 100%;
	overflow: scroll;
	border: 0px	 solid #666;		
	padding: 8px;		
	scrollbar-3dlight-color:    #999966;
	scrollbar-arrow-color:      #999966;
	scrollbar-darkshadow-color: #999966;
	scrollbar-face-color:       #dddca3;
	scrollbar-highlight-color:  #dddca3;
	scrollbar-shadow-color:     #dddca3;
	scrollbar-track-color:      #999966
}
.tdmenu
{
	width:20%
}

A:link  {
    text-decoration: none;
    color:  black;
}

A, A:hover {
    text-decoration: underline;
    color:  black;
}

SMALL   {
    font-size:  8px;
}

BIG {
    font-size:  14px;
}

BLOCKQUOTE, PRE {
    font-family:    Lucida Console, monospace;
}


UL LI   {
    list-style-type:    square ;
}

UL LI LI    {
    list-style-type:    disc;
}

UL LI LI LI {
    list-style-type:    circle;
}

OL LI   {
    list-style-type:    decimal;
}

OL OL LI    {
    list-style-type:    lower-alpha;
}

OL OL OL LI {
    list-style-type:    lower-roman;
}

HR {
    height:1pt;
    text-align:left
}


